乡村主题民宿国外文献 In recent years, rural theme homestays have become a popular form of accommodation for tourists seeking a unique and authentic travel experience. While the concept has gained significant traction in countries like China and Japan, it has also been embraced by travelers around the world. There is a growing body of literature that explores the rise of rural theme homestays and their impact on the tourism industry. One notable article by Kim and Morrison (2016) examines the motivations of tourists who are drawn to rural accommodations. The authors conducted a survey of tourists in two regions of Korea and found that respondents were primarily interested in experiencing nature, relaxing, and enjoying local cuisine. They also found that tourists who stayed in rural accommodations were more likely to participate in activities like hiking and cultural tours, which added value to their trip. Another study by Lashley and Morrison (2017) looked at the economic impacts of rural homestays. The authors conducted a case study in a Scottish village and found that the introduction of homestays had led to an increase in tourism spending and job creation. They also noted that the homestays had helped to preserve local traditions and culture by providing tourists with a closer look at rural life. In addition to economic benefits, rural homestays can also foster cultural exchange and cross-cultural learning. A study by Zhang and Lyu (2020) explores the experiences of Chinese tourists staying in rural homestays in Japan. The authors found that tourists enjoyed the opportunity to interact with local residents and learn about traditional Japanese customs and culture. The authors argue that rural homestays can serve as a platform for cultural exchange and bridge-building between different communities.
